Mobile Proxies Basics
Mobile proxies pull IPs from real mobile devices connected to cellular networks like 4G or 5G towers. These IPs come from carriers such as AT&T or Verizon, rotating naturally as phones move between cells. That rotation mimics organic user behavior, which helps dodge detection on sites that flag data center traffic.
You get them through providers who manage pools of actual phones or SIM cards. Sessions can stick for minutes or hours, but expect some natural churn. They're pricey because of the hardware and data costs involved. Pool sizes run into millions, covering urban areas worldwide where signal is strong.
For tasks like checking geo-locked ads, they shine since the IPs look like everyday mobile users. But speeds vary with network congestion—downtown rush hour might slow you down.
ISP Proxies Explained
ISP proxies, sometimes called static residential, use IPs assigned by internet service providers but routed through data centers. Think Comcast or BT handing out blocks that providers lease. These IPs appear residential to websites but stay fixed on your end, no constant rotation unless you configure it.
They're faster and more stable than pure datacenter proxies because the IPs carry that home ISP flavor. You can hold a session for days if needed. Costs sit lower than mobile, with larger dedicated pools for high-volume work. Coverage hits major cities, often with state-level precision.
Good for long-running scrapes or SEO tools where you need consistency without burning through IPs constantly.
Head-to-Head: Key Differences
Mobile and ISP proxies both beat datacenter ones for authenticity, but they split on trade-offs. Here's a breakdown:
Anonymity: Mobile edges out with carrier-grade rotation; sites see them as phones. ISP looks residential but static, so easier to flag if overused.
Speed: ISP wins—consistent 50-100Mbps. Mobile fluctuates 10-50Mbps based on tower load.
Stability: ISP for the win on sticky sessions up to weeks. Mobile rotates every 5-60 minutes typically.
Cost: Mobile runs 2-5x higher per GB. ISP cheaper for bulk.
Pool Size: Both scale to 10M+, but mobile scarcer in rural spots.
Detection Risk: Mobile lower for bot-heavy sites; ISP better for speed-focused tasks.
Pick based on your bottleneck: evasion or throughput.
